代码之家  ›  专栏  ›  技术社区  ›  nikitablack

图形和当前队列真的可以不同吗?

  •  2
  • nikitablack  · 技术社区  · 6 年前

    几乎所有的示例和教程都处理图形队列索引和当前队列索引不同的情况。但在对多个GPU进行测试后,我发现它们总是一样的。

    问题是-他们会有什么不同的机会?只能在旧硬件上发生吗?如果我不处理这种情况,将来安全吗?

    1 回复  |  直到 6 年前
        1
  •  2
  •   Ekzuzy    6 年前

    在这方面,规范是明确的——它允许图形和当前队列是不同的。所以如果你想符合规范,你应该处理这种情况。

    实际上,在大多数常见的操作系统(如Windows或Linux)上,我怀疑它会是case-graphics和present队列通常是相同的。但我也怀疑你能否找到一个能保证将来不会改变的人。目前的情况如前所述,但未来1年、2年或5年的情况如何?我不知道。所以,正如我写的,规格是明确的。如果你想确保你的代码正确工作,你必须处理这种情况。